Before the Wedding:

  • Hydration is Key: When you first receive your bridal bouquet, it’s time to hydrate. Trim a bit off the bottom of each stem and place them in fresh, lukewarm, water.
  • Cool, Dark, and Calm: Store your bridal bouquet in a cool, dark place away from direct sunlight, heat sources, and air vents. A refrigerator is ideal, but a cool room will also work well.
  • Avoid Fruit & Veggies: Keep your bridal bouquet away from any ripening fruit and vegetables, whether on the counter or in the refrigerator. Fruits and veggies release ethylene gas, which can cause flowers to wilt prematurely.

The Big Day:

  • Water Breaks: Throughout the day, make sure your bouquet has access to water whenever possible. Ask a bridesmaid or family member to place your wedding bouquet in a vase when not in use. It’s best to trim the stems before refreshing.
  • Handle with Care: Avoid touching the flower blooms too much, as this can cause bruising and damage. Transport carefully, being sure not to keep the flowers from resting against or bumping into anything.
  • Picture Perfect: When posing for photos, hold your wedding bouquet slightly away from your dress to avoid staining or snagging.

After the Wedding:

  • Back to the Water: As soon as the festivities wind down, re-trim the stems and place your wedding bouquet back in fresh water.
  • Preservation Options:
    • Drying: Hang your bridal bouquet upside down in a cool, dark, and well-ventilated area. This will preserve its shape and color for months or even years.
    • Pressing: Press individual flowers between the pages of a heavy book to create beautiful keepsakes for framing or crafting.
    • Professional Preservation: Consider professional preservation methods like freeze-drying or resin encapsulation to create a lasting memento.

Bonus Tips:

  • Florist Hack: A light mist of professional floral spray can help preserve the shape and vibrancy of your bridal bouquet.
  • Avoid Overcrowding: Don’t cram your wedding bouquet into a tight vase. Give the flowers some space to breathe.
